Output 11666921dce12a7c3f915928437b3601b39f9922fddb088adccf982a18f15dd4:0

value
62681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6774d983727fec795d6536e8109b6486f688ac8 OP_EQUAL
address
3NhcFzMhgL78SPhHAXWYnyXxY5z4aby4FS
transaction
11666921dce12a7c3f915928437b3601b39f9922fddb088adccf982a18f15dd4